The shortlist for Stratford-on-Avon District Council Building Control's Built in Quality Awards has been drawn up and all the finalists will be invited to the awards ceremony at Stratford-on-Avon District Council on Friday 12 March 2010 where they will be presented with their awards.

The Built in Quality Awards look to award those that have achieved construction standards beyond what would normally be expected and have been truly built in quality. 

All completed projects on which the District Council's Building Control has worked on in the last three years were eligible for the awards and there were a number of categories ranging from the smallest domestic extension through to multi million pound commercial developments.

Stratford-on-Avon District Council's Building Control team are the leading providers of Building Control services in the Stratford District and are committed to working with customers to produce high quality buildings that comply with the ever more demanding Building Regulations.
